Quick tip to hide phone number: *67
One of the quickest and easiest ways to hide your phone number when calling someone is to use the *67 trick while dialing. This will make your phone number registered as “Private” to the person you are calling. You will have to dial *67 every time you want to make a call with a hidden number. If you only want to hide your phone number occasionally, this is a good way to do it.
How to use the trick to hide phone number
Almost all Android devices with almost every carrier have the option to hide your phone number by default, you don't have to dial *67 every time you make a call anymore. Here's how to block your phone number using the built-in Hide Number feature on your Android device.
1. Select the phone icon in the application menu or at the bottom of the device's home screen.
2. Select the 3-dot menu icon in the upper right corner of the window.
3. Select Settings .
4. Select Calls .
5. Select Additional settings .
6. When the process is finished, select Caller ID .
7. Select Hide Number from the pop-up menu.
This phone number blocking trick will make your phone number never show up when you call someone, instead of showing up as Blocked , Private or No Caller ID . If you want your phone number to show up again for a short time, you can dial *82 . Also, if you want to turn off the phone number blocking feature, repeat the steps above and at the end, select Network Default or Show Number .
